7 Headless CMS Examples to Help You Get Started
Discover seven examples of headless CMS platforms that can help you kickstart your website development.
A headless CMS has become an essential tool for many businesses and individuals looking to manage their website content efficiently. This article will explore the concept of a headless CMS, its advantages, and provide a detailed comparison of popular headless CMS options available in the market. By the end, you'll have a clear understanding of headless CMS solutions and be equipped to make an informed choice for your website needs.
What is a Headless CMS?
A headless CMS is a content management system that focuses solely on providing an easy way to create, manage, and deliver content. Unlike traditional CMS platforms, a headless CMS separates the content management backend from the frontend presentation, allowing for more flexibility and scalability in website development.
But let's dive deeper into the concept of a headless CMS. Understanding how it works can help you appreciate its benefits even more.
Understanding the concept of a Headless CMS
A headless CMS works by decoupling the content creation and management process from the presentation layer. This means that the content stored in a headless CMS can be accessed and displayed on various frontend frameworks and devices, such as websites, mobile apps, and even smart devices.
Imagine this: you have a headless CMS backend where you can create, organize, and manage your content. It's like a treasure trove of information waiting to be utilized. On the other hand, the frontend, which can be built using different technologies, retrieves and displays the content using APIs (Application Programming Interfaces) or webhooks.
This separation of concerns allows developers to have complete control over the presentation layer. They can choose the best frontend technology for their needs, resulting in faster development cycles and improved user experiences.
Key features and benefits of a Headless CMS
A headless CMS offers several key features that make it an attractive option for website development:
- Flexibility: With a headless CMS, you have the freedom to choose the best frontend technology for your needs. You can use popular frameworks like React, Angular, or Vue.js to build your website or app. This flexibility empowers developers to create stunning and interactive user interfaces.
- Scalability: Headless CMS solutions are designed to handle large amounts of content and traffic, making them suitable for websites with high growth potential. Whether you have hundreds or millions of users, a headless CMS can handle the load without breaking a sweat.
- Content Reusability: With a headless CMS, you can create content once and reuse it across multiple platforms. Let's say you have a blog post. You can use the same content for your website, mobile app, and even IoT devices. This eliminates the need for duplicating content and ensures consistency across different channels.
- Security: By separating the frontend and backend, headless CMS solutions provide an additional layer of security. Potential attackers have a harder time exploiting vulnerabilities because they can't directly access the backend. This added security measure helps protect your valuable content and user data.
So, as you can see, a headless CMS offers a world of possibilities for developers and content creators. It empowers them to build dynamic and scalable websites and applications while ensuring a seamless user experience across different devices and platforms.
Why Use a Headless CMS?
There are several reasons why using a headless CMS for your website can be highly beneficial:
Advantages of using a Headless CMS
1. Improved Website Performance: One of the primary advantages of a headless CMS is its ability to improve website performance. By decoupling the frontend and backend, the website's frontend can be optimized for speed and responsiveness without the limitations imposed by an integrated CMS.
2. Seamless Omni-channel Content Delivery: With a headless CMS, you can easily deliver your content on multiple channels simultaneously, such as websites, mobile apps, social media platforms, and digital signage. This ensures consistent messaging and allows you to reach a wider audience.
3. Future-proofing Your Website: A headless CMS provides the flexibility to adapt to changing technologies and user preferences. As new frontend frameworks and devices emerge, you can easily update and maintain your website without the need for a complete overhaul.
Choosing the Right Headless CMS for Your Needs
With several headless CMS options available in the market, it's essential to consider a few factors before making a decision:
Factors to consider when selecting a Headless CMS
1. Ease of Use: Look for a headless CMS that comes with an intuitive interface and a user-friendly content editor. This will make it easier for your team to create and manage content without the need for extensive technical knowledge.
2. Customization Options: Determine if the headless CMS allows you to customize the content structure and integrate with your existing systems. This will ensure that the CMS aligns with your specific requirements.
3. Developer-Friendly Features: If you have in-house development resources or plan to work with developers, choose a headless CMS that offers robust APIs, extensive documentation, and support for modern web technologies like GraphQL.
Comparison of popular Headless CMS options
Here are some popular headless CMS options worth considering:
- Contentful: Contentful is a versatile headless CMS that offers excellent developer tools, a user-friendly interface, and a range of content modeling options.
- Prismic: Prismic is known for its user-friendly interface, content relationships, and rich content modeling capabilities, making it a great choice for content-heavy websites.
- Sanity: Sanity is a developer-friendly headless CMS that provides real-time collaboration, structured content models, and GraphQL support.
- Strapi: Strapi is an open-source headless CMS that offers a self-hosted solution, custom content types, and a plugin system for extensibility.
- Kentico Kontent: Kentico Kontent is a scalable headless CMS that provides an intuitive content editor, localization support, and easy integration with other services.
- ButterCMS: ButterCMS is a headless CMS designed specifically for blogs and websites, offering features like SEO optimization, caching, and content versioning.
- GraphCMS: GraphCMS is a headless CMS built for GraphQL enthusiasts, offering a powerful GraphQL API, schema generation, and rich content modeling capabilities.
Headless CMS Examples
Let's take a closer look at some of the popular headless CMS examples:
Example 1: Contentful - A versatile Headless CMS
Contentful is widely recognized for its flexibility and extensive range of features. It offers a rich set of APIs, multi-language support, and built-in version control. Contentful allows you to create content models tailored to your specific needs and delivers content through high-performance global CDN.
Example 2: Prismic - A user-friendly Headless CMS
Prismic is known for its intuitive interface and powerful content modeling capabilities. It provides an easy-to-use visual editor, content relationships, and dynamic content previews. Prismic's API allows developers to build custom frontend experiences using their preferred technologies.
Example 3: Sanity - A developer-friendly Headless CMS
Sanity stands out for its real-time collaboration and structured content modeling. It offers a customizable editor, live preview functionality, and powerful query capabilities with GraphQL support. Sanity's wide array of plugins enables seamless integration with popular frameworks and third-party services.
Example 4: Strapi - An open-source Headless CMS
Strapi is a self-hosted headless CMS that provides complete control over your data and content. It offers an intuitive interface, custom content types, and a plugin system for extensibility. Strapi's REST and GraphQL APIs make it easy to consume content in your preferred frontend framework.
Example 5: Kentico Kontent - A scalable Headless CMS
Kentico Kontent offers a user-friendly experience with its intuitive content editor and flexible content modeling. It provides localization support, allowing you to create and manage content for multiple languages. Kentico Kontent's seamless integration with other services makes it an excellent choice for building complex and scalable projects.
Example 6: ButterCMS - A Headless CMS for blogs and websites
ButterCMS is a headless CMS specifically designed for managing content for blogs and websites. It offers a simple and intuitive content editor, SEO optimization features, and caching for improved performance. ButterCMS allows you to draft and review content before publishing, ensuring quality control.
Example 7: GraphCMS - A Headless CMS for GraphQL enthusiasts
GraphCMS is a headless CMS that embraces GraphQL as its primary API. It provides a powerful and flexible GraphQL API as well as automatic schema generation. GraphCMS allows you to define rich content models and relationships, making it easy to fetch and manipulate data in a GraphQL-centric application.
Before making a decision, consider your specific requirements, budget, and technical expertise. These examples will give you a good starting point in your headless CMS journey.
Now that you have a solid understanding of headless CMS solutions and a comparison of popular options, you can confidently choose the right headless CMS for your website needs. Remember to consider factors like ease of use, customization options, and developer-friendly features. Whether you opt for Contentful, Prismic, Sanity, Strapi, Kentico Kontent, ButterCMS, or GraphCMS, you'll be well on your way to a powerful headless CMS solution for your website.
If you're in need of a versatile digital asset management platform to complement your headless CMS, consider exploring HIVO. HIVO provides a centralized hub for managing and organizing your digital assets, making it easy to integrate and deliver assets across your website and other channels. With features like metadata management, version control, and collaborative workflows, HIVO empowers teams to streamline their digital asset management process and enhance their overall content strategy.
So, what are you waiting for? Explore the world of headless CMS solutions, choose the one that aligns with your needs, and unlock the power of seamless content management and delivery.